In the quest for a comfortable home and cost-effective energy usage, insulation plays a pivotal role. In an area like East Tennessee with hot summers and sometimes very cold winters, having proper insulation is not just a luxury but a necessity. It’s the silent guardian of your home’s comfort and efficiency, significantly impacting your heating and air conditioning bills.

Why is insulation so crucial? The answer lies in its ability to regulate temperature. In winter, insulation helps retain heat, reducing the demand on your heating system. Conversely, during the hot summer months, it keeps the heat out, ensuring your air conditioning doesn’t overwork. This dual role makes insulation a year-round ally in maintaining a comfortable home environment and reducing energy costs.
